Transaction e84236e17c534e25f00f4fcb82b26cd31c39b8b73feb7b641d820e1bf35adcc1
1 Input
1 Output
-
e84236e17c534e25f00f4fcb82b26cd31c39b8b73feb7b641d820e1bf35adcc1:0
- value
- 653396
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c68c00c4f6134fa030a51f3481c64c236bdfbdd5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1K6pWZaokZP45jhZHarJupoVCYZuuJCSDt